With the launch of Season 2 in Dragonflight, two entirely new currencies were introduced—Flightstones and Awakened Crests. In this guide, we will explain how to get Flightstones in WoW Dragonflight using the most effective and time-saving methods available.
This new currency replaces Valor, which previously served as the resource for upgrading gear. Thankfully, Blizzard has added numerous ways for players to collect this fresh currency. We’ll cover each one in detail below, helping you fully understand the revamped gearing system in Dragonflight.

In contrast to Shadowflame Crests, Flightstones are predominantly used for upgrading lower-tier gear and are much easier to acquire. While they do play a role at higher gear levels, Shadowflame Crests become more essential the further you progress.
It’s worth noting that there is no weekly farming limit for Flightstones. The only cap is your inventory limit—2,000 pieces. Additionally, this currency is not transferable between characters on your account.

Besides regular Flightstones, you’ll also find Empowered Flightstones in the game. To obtain these, you’ll need to visit certain NPCs located throughout the Dragon Isles:
Each Empowered Flightstone costs 150 Flightstones. This upgraded currency is used to enhance crafted gear from item level 395 up to 447. Note that you will also require Shadowflame Crests for these enhancements.
Converting your Flightstones into Empowered versions can also help manage your inventory. However, you can only hold a maximum of 1,000 Empowered Flightstones at once.
Empowered Flightstones also allow the crafting of Titan Training Matrix V—an Enchanting recipe used to set gear ilvl between 382 and 395.
You’re already familiar with the gear ranking system. Each rank includes eight upgrade levels. Initially, you’ll only need Flightstones to climb through them. But as your gear improves, Shadowflame Crests become necessary for further upgrades.
To optimize your use of Flightstones, make sure you’re leveraging the account-wide upgrade discount. For example, if you’ve already upgraded a necklace to Veteran ilvl 415, the next necklace you acquire can be upgraded to that same level for only 50% of the regular Flightstone cost. This discount applies across all characters on your account. Unfortunately, a similar account-wide discount does not exist for Shadowflame Crests.

You can obtain Flightstones by participating in various PvE activities, including World Quests, finding Treasures, defeating Rares and Rare Elites, completing Fyrakk Assaults, taking down Weekly Bosses, running Mythic+ dungeons, and clearing Raids.
Flightstones are primarily used to upgrade your PvE gear. You can raise your item level up to 398 using only Flightstones. To continue upgrading beyond that point, you'll also need Shadowflame Crests.
